Gnumeric 1.1.20 unleashed!

This release of GNOME's spreadsheet is _huge_. We've spent the last 2 months squashing bugs, getting the docs in shape, and polishing up the text importer. Trying to summarise the NEWS entries is daunting.

Gnumeric-1.1 is now in beta mode. We'll be doing weekly releases until 1.2.0 comes out hopefully on Sept 8. This includes a string freeze everywhere accept the charting engine. The charts are now somewhat useful, Emmanuel contributed ring, line and area plot support, Jean greased up the gradients, and I tacked on patterns. There are still some rough edges but you can get real work done now.

We also hit a major milestone. All of the worksheet functions in the US version of MS Excel are now supported. The text importer has now been cleanup, and should address all of the common requests for the 1.0.x version.
